F5 JWK is a 1992 Ford Sierra in Red with a 1,998cc petrol engine. This vehicle has been through 28 MOT tests with a personal pass rate of 67.9%.
Across all 1992 Ford Sierra models, the average MOT pass rate is 67.6% with a typical mileage of 48,936 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Ford Sierra f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 24,833 recorded failures. If you're considering buying F5 JWK, it's worth having these areas checked by a mechanic before committing.
The Ford Sierra typically stays on UK roads for around 43 years. At 34 years old, this Ford Sierra is well into its expected lifespan but still has years ahead.
